McCauley Lecture: George Washington's Connections to Our County: Legends, Lore, and Alliances
6:00pm–7:30pm
Alice Virginia & David W. Fletcher Branch
Library Branch:
Alice Virginia & David W. Fletcher Branch
Room:
Combined Community Room 308/309
Age Group:
Teens & YA (13-18),
Adults
Program Type:
Cultural Heritage & Genealogy,
Holiday/Seasonal
Event Details:
George Washington slept here, travelled through here, and corresponded with Fort Frederick and with local citizens who were prominent in the Revolutionary War. He also scouted out Williamsport as a location for the new nation's capital.
